Resilient Tech Talent is seeking a Network Manager to support the City of Suffolk’s IT initiatives. This is a project-based W-2 assignment with no guaranteed minimum hours. Work is performed on-site at City locations, with assignments that may vary based on departmental needs.
Location: Suffolk, VA (On-site work required; some roles may allow limited hybrid flexibility)
Employment Type: W-2, Project-Based
Hourly Pay Rate: $61.90/hour
Primary Responsibilities- Lead and oversee network operations, team supervision, and project execution.
Skills & Qualifications
- 5+ years in network leadership
- Cisco or similar certifications
- Ability to pass a background check and drug screening
- Some roles may require fingerprinting or CJIS background checks, administered at Suffolk Police Headquarters.
- Conversion to full-time City employment may be possible.
